Özet (EN)

We study a multicommodity network flow problem faced by a third party logisticscompany that has the possibility of using ground and maritime transportation.We are given a set of commodities which should be picked up from their originsat given release times and should be delivered to their destinations no later thantheir duedates. The commodities may be carried directly from their origins totheir destinations on trucks, or they may be carried on trucks to a seaport, mayvisit several seaports using maritime services, and then to be carried to their destinationson trucks. There is no capacity and time limitation on the use of groundtransportation. However, the maritime services are scheduled in advance and thecompany has limitations on the amounts of volume that it can use on each service.The aim is to determine routes for commodities in order to minimize the sum oftransportation cost and stocking costs at seaports, respecting the capacity andtime related constraints. We call this problem the ?Multimodal MulticommodityRouting Problem with Scheduled Services (MMR-S)?. We first prove that theproblem is NP-hard. Next, we propose a first mixed integer programming formulationand strengthen it using variable fixing and valid inequalities.We relax thecapacity constraints in a Lagrangian manner and show that the relaxed problemsdecompose into a series of shortest path problems defined on networks augmentedby time for each commodity. The corresponding Lagrangian dual yields a lowerbound, which may be stronger than that of the linear programming relaxationof our first formulation. Then, we provide an extended formulation whose linearprogramming relaxation gives the same bound as the Lagrangian dual. Finally,we use the Lagrangian relaxation to devise heuristic methods and report theresults of our computational study.
